Abstract
The utility model is related to a kind of replacing concrete turnout sleeper embedded sleeve pipe heat melting device, including end cap, handle, body, hot melt termination and control panel, body is up big and down small structure, have on body for controlling the control panel of heat melting device, end cap, handle and hot melt termination, there is the aperture of radiating body lower section, bottom of the pipe is connected with hot melt termination, there is wire in body;Hot melt termination surrounding has four longitudinal direction semicircle projections, internal surface of sleeve pipe surrounding is melt into four grooves of same shape after the heating, in order to dismantle.When needing to change, by this heat melting device to the sleeve pipe high temperature melt damaged, and whole sleeve pipe is screwed out by socket wrench insertion, be then threaded into an intact sleeve pipe, to reach the purpose of replacing after casing failure.The utility model simple structure, operation flexibly, sleeve pipe change it is quick, reduce production cost and improve switch tie utilization rate;It is it is a kind of damaged for concrete turnout sleeper embedded sleeve pipe after carry out the heat melting device of replacement operation.

This heat melting device was first smashed before the service sleeve that dismounting has been damaged with the internal thread inside electric hammer grip pipe,
Make endoporus surrounding smooth, then remove the foreign matter existed in sleeve pipe, it is ensured that carry out next step work again after the no-sundries of sleeve pipe the inside
Make.First have to determine the fusing point of sleeve pipe, it is convenient temperature has been controlled in follow-up operating process.In the course of work, be first
Heat melting device is preheated, after temperature reaches to a certain degree, both hands hold handle 4, make termination center alignment sleeve endoporus
Center, will heat the sleeve pipe the inside that termination 6 is inserted into damage from top to bottom, extract after hot melt termination is inserted into bottom and then lightly
Come.Four grooves of same shape will be so formed inside the endoporus of sleeve pipe, after heat melting device is extracted completely, sleeve pipe is allowed
After being cooled to and being hardened, then it is embedded among sleeve pipe with socket wrench, rotate counterclockwise can directly extract whole damage once enclosing
The sleeve pipe for breaking down, then changes a brand-new sleeve pipe again, this completes the replacing to damaging sleeve pipe.After work is completed
Heat melting device is cleared up and checked, it is ensured that next time can normally be used.
